What is this part?

I found this leaking fuel today in my 88 F250, it's located on the drivers side frame rail behind the fuel filter and fuel pump. It has four fuel lines that run into it from the back and two that run out the otherside to the fuel pump and filter. I thought it was some type of regulator for the dual tanks, but there are no electronics connected to it...




As you can see the top two male ends that connect to the fuel lines have been sheered off. It has the Ford logo on it.. all I'm sure is it's probably pricey to replace, any help is appreciated!

It's the fuel selector valve. Switching is done by pressure from the in-tank fuel pumps. If you scroll down the main page to the fuel injection section, there's a thread with the part number in it for what you need to order.
